About Kepler-1743 b
Kepler-1743 b is a rare exoplanet. It lies about 1,757.4 light-years from Earth, shines at apparent magnitude 12.06, has an equilibrium temperature near 1,144 K and spans roughly 1.6 Earth radii.
It orbits closer to its star than Mercury does to the Sun, completing a lap in less time than Mercury takes.
